Semi Truck Accident Settlement Contrary, to most car accidents, collisions involving semi trucks can result in serious injuries. This is why these claims can take longer to settle. Getting a fair semi truck settlement from an accident is contingent upon a variety of factors, including the extent of the injuries suffered by the victim and their economic damages. These damages could include medical expenses, lost income and pain and discomfort. Damages The amount you can claim as a semi-truck accident settlement depends on several factors, including your injuries' severity and how they've affected your life. Medical bills and lost wages are the most obvious expenses you can include in a claim. However, other losses can also be a reason to seek compensation. You could be entitled to compensation for long-term medical care, the inability to work as a result of your injuries or the cost to repair or replace your vehicle. Additionally, you could also seek damages to compensate for the psychological effect of the incident on your quality of life and your relationships. An attorney can help comprehend the full scope of your losses and how they affect your future. They'll speak to your doctors and request experts to assess both current and future losses. If you are in a car crash that involves a semi truck it is essential to collect as much evidence as possible to present in your case. Photograph your injuries as well as your vehicle. It's also important to obtain the names and contact information of any witnesses who can help your case. Trucking accidents can be complicated and often involve multiple parties. Additionally, many trucking companies have commercial insurance policies that are not the same as regular auto insurance policies. This means it can be a challenge to contact an agent and determine who is accountable for the accident. Medical bills Truck accidents are typically more serious than other accidents, and the results can be devastating financially. Therefore, compensation amounts in these cases are usually higher than the average settlement from an accident. This is due to the fact that semi-trucks are larger and weigh more than normal motor vehicles. Therefore, even a small collision with a semi truck can cause serious injuries to its victims and extensive property damage. Following a collision with an 18-wheeler, the victims are likely to incur medical expenses. Many victims will have to be hospitalized for a long duration due to the seriousness of these accidents. In addition, those injured may have ongoing needs for rehabilitation and therapy. It's therefore important to ensure that all medical costs and related expenses are included in the settlement of the truck crash. In addition to medical costs as well as medical expenses, you could also be able to get the cost of any property damage you suffered during the collision. This includes items such as your damaged vehicle and any other property damaged or destroyed during the collision. You may also be eligible to claim compensation for lost wages or diminished earning potential because of the accident. Furthermore, you can seek compensation for the pain and suffering. This is a form of damage that is hard to quantify, but it's crucial to think about the impact your injuries have had on your life. This could include things such as your emotional distress and loss of enjoyment in life, as well as physical suffering and pain. Lost wages To operate their vehicles safely, truck drivers must follow strict local and state regulations. Despite these regulations accidents do happen and people suffer injuries. If you've been injured in an accident involving a semi-truck, you could be entitled to compensation. You may also claim compensation in the event that you lose income. This is particularly important in the event that your injuries hinder you from returning to your previous job or even working. If you suffer from a brain injury that stops you from being able to think or move the same as before the accident, you could be entitled to compensation for the loss of earning potential in the future. Other losses that may be claimed are suffering and pain. This is a subjective word which is difficult to quantify. The amount you can receive for this will depend on the physical and emotional hurt you've experienced due to your collision with a vehicle.
